The History and Evolution of Casinos in Benin

Gambling in Benin has roots tracing back to colonial times, but it wasn’t until the late 20th century that formal casinos began to emerge. The government legalized gambling in the 1990s to boost tourism and revenue, leading to the establishment of several gaming establishments primarily in urban centers. Today, ‘casino Benin’ refers to a regulated industry overseen by the Ministry of Economy and Finance, ensuring fair play and responsible gaming practices.

Top Locations for Casino Benin Experiences

When it comes to finding a ‘casino Benin,’ the capital city of Cotonou stands out as the epicenter. Here, you’ll find modern facilities equipped with slot machines, table games, and even live entertainment. Other areas like Porto-Novo and coastal regions offer smaller, more intimate settings. For travelers, combining a casino visit with Benin’s beaches and voodoo festivals can create a memorable itinerary.

Popular Games and Attractions

Common games include blackjack, roulette, poker, and a variety of slot machines. Many venues also feature sports betting, especially on football, which is hugely popular in West Africa. Tips for Enjoying Casinos in Benin Safely

To make the most of your ‘casino Benin’ adventure, prioritize safety and strategy. Research venues in advance, focusing on those with positive reviews for security and fairness. Dress codes are often smart casual, and knowing basic French can enhance interactions, as it’s the official language.
